Some kinds of mental skills naturally decrease as people get older.[16]Yet research seem to show that some training can improve such skills. A recently published study also appears to demonstrate that the good effects of training can last for many years after that training has ended.
Researchers at Johns Hopkins University in Maryland, wanted to learn how long memory and thinking skills would last in older people who trained to keep them. The people were part of the ten-year research project. They were taught methods meant to improve their memory, thinking and ability to perform everyday tasks.
More than 2,800 volunteered for the study. Most studied when they were more than 70 years old. The volunteers took one of several short training classes meant to help them keep their mental abilities. One class trained participants in skills including how to remember word lists. Another group trained in reasoning. A third group received help with speed-of-processing—speed of receivings and understanding information. A fourth group—the control group did not get any training.
Earlier results had established that the training helped the participants for up to five years. Now, lead study writer George Rebok says, the research showed most of the training remained effective a full ten years later. Professor Rebok and his team found that the people trained in reasoning and speed-of-processing did better on tests than the control group. They are wondering whether those effects which endured over time would still be there ten years following the training, and in fact, that’s exactly what they found.
